JBL Bio

Before wrestling JBL was a professional football player. He started wrestling in 1992 in the Global Wrestling Federation. In the late part of 1995 JBL appeared on the WWF as Justin"Hawk" Bradshaw, his character was that of a tough cowboy/mountain man. He teamed up with Barry Windham but when Barry Windham had to leave because of injuries JBL just became a generic wrestler who would show up once in a while and was called just 'Bradshaw'. In 1998 JBL teamed with Faaroog and they were called the APA. They were faces and ended up winning the tag team titles three different times. In 2002 the APA had to split because of the WWE draft and JBL went to Raw. After an injury kept JBL out of action for 6 months he returned to Smackdown and once again teamed up with Faaroog, only this time he had a new look. He shaved his long hair, stopped dying it black and had no facial hair. The two then had a tag team match were the loser would have to retire, APA lost and Faaroog had to retire (in reality he was just retiring from the WWE). The Smackdown GM told JBL that the retirement thing didn't apply to him and despite it looking like JBL turned on Faaroog on screen, in real life these two are two best friends. The next week JBl became a heel with a cowboy hat, a suit and a tie and began using the name JBL or John "Bradshaw" Layfield. Many of his feuds were with Eddie Guerrero and Kurt Angle. JBL became the WWE Heavyweight Champion and labeled himself the 'wrestling god'. He held on to the title for nine months, losing it to John Cena. In May of 2006 JBL participated in a match were the loser would have to retire, JBL lost. In June of 06 he took over as color commentator for Smackdown alongside Michael Cole. He continued as commentator until December of 2007 when he announced that he was going to RAW to start wrestling again due to a challenge by Chris Jericho. He went on to defeat Jericho at the 2008 Royal Rumble. In February JBL announced to everyone that Hornswoggle was not really Mr. McMahan's son and that his real father was Finlay which Finlay later admitted. This caused a big rivalry between JBL and Finlay who would later meet up in a Belfast Brawl at Wrestlemania XXIV to settle their differences. JBL was able to capture the win at Wrestlemania over Finlay. JBL competed for the WWE Title at Backlash in a fatal four way elimination match against John Cena, Randy Orton and Triple H. JBL was not successful though as he was the first one eliminated.

On the July 30, 2008 edition of Raw JBL challenged CM Punk for his World Heavyweight Championship belt. CM Punk had only won the gold that night when he cashed in his Money in the Bank contract to steal it from Edge after Edge had taken a beating from Batista. JBL was unsuccessful in his attempt for the gold as CM Punk beat him.

JBL would later compete in a four way match with John Cena, Batista and Kane to see who would battle CM Punk for the World Heavyweight Championship at the Great American Bash. Batista won that match but it fueled the feud between JBL and John Cena. They would meet up July 20, 2008 at the Great American Bash in a parking lot brawl which involved a lot of cars crashing into each other. JBL was able to pick up the win when he pinned Cena on top of a car.

On August 17, 2008 JBL would get another chance at the World Heavyweight Title against CM Punk but was unsuccessful.

On October 5, 2008 at No Mercy JBL would have a match with Batista. The winner would win the honor of becoming the number one contender for the World Heavyweight Title. JBL lost though after Batista hit a Spinebuster and a Batista Bomb.

JBL then began feuding with Shawn Michaels. It became known that Michael's wa going through a tough time financially. JBL offered to help Shawn out with a deal to have Shawn work for him and at Armageddon 2008 Michaels accepted the deal. This feud is based on the film The Wrestler, which was released the week after Armageddon. With help from his new employee, Shawn Michaels, JBL won a Fatal Four-Way Elimination match on the December 29, 2008 episode of Raw by defeating Chris Jericho, Randy Orton and Shawn Michaels, earning JBL a World Heavyweight Championship match at the Royal Rumble against John Cena.

At the 2009 Royal Rumble JBL would face Cena for the World Heavyweight Championship but would lose the match after Cena reversed a JBL Clothesline From Hell and turned it into a FU. During the match, Shawn Michaels kicked both JBL and Cena down and then put JBL on top of Cena before leaving the ring, unfortunately for JBL, it didn't help.

The JBL and Shawn Michaels situation had been going on for months but all would be laid on the line as the two would battle on February 15, 2009 at No Way Out in a All or Nothing Match. Late in the match, Michaels would hit his Sweet Chin Music to win it, saving himself and his wife Rebecca from becoming JBL's property! Rebecca cried happily in the crowd as Michaels celebrated in the ring.

On March 9th, 2009 JBL would win the Intercontinental Championship from CM Punk.

With Wrestlemania 25 not far away there started to be talk about who would face the Undertaker and try to end the streak. What eventually went down was a match between Shawn Michaels and JBL with the winner taking on the Undertaker at Wrestlemania. JBL lost the match but would still make a Wrestlemania appearance as he defended his Intercontinental title against Rey Mysterio. That was not a good day for JBL as he lost the title to Rey in only 21 seconds as Mysterio was able to knock JBL down, hit the 619 and hit a slash from the top ropes before the pinfall and the IC belt. After the match was over JBL grabbed the Mic and announced to the crowd "I Quite!" before dropping the mic and walking off.

In April of 2009, days after Layfield's retirement, OVW owner Danny Davis announced in a press-release that Layfield was to become a commentator and host for the up-start MMA promotion and OVW's affiliate Vyper Fight League in which Layfield also sponsors with Layfield Energy.

JBL Facts:

Birth Name: John Charles Layfield
Birth Date: November 29, 1966
Height: 6' ft 6' inch
Finishing Move: Clothesline from hell
